Free T4 is a thyroid hormone that serves as a precursor to Free T3, helping regulate metabolism, energy production, and body temperature. Low Free T4 levels suggest hypothyroidism, leading to sluggish metabolism and fatigue, while high levels indicate hyperthyroidism, causing nervousness and rapid weight loss. Monitoring Free T4 ensures proper thyroid function, helping maintain metabolic balance, cognitive function, and cardiovascular stability.
Low Free T4 is commonly caused by iodine deficiency, hypothyroidism, or chronic illness. Nutrient deficiencies, stress, and some medications can also impair thyroid hormone production. High Free T4 is often due to hyperthyroidism, excessive iodine intake, or autoimmune disorders like Graves' disease. Identifying and addressing thyroid dysfunction helps regulate metabolism and prevent long-term complications related to hormonal imbalances.
Low Free T4 can cause fatigue, cold sensitivity, dry skin, depression, and difficulty losing weight. High Free T4 may result in rapid heartbeat, anxiety, irritability, sweating, and unintended weight loss. Long-term imbalances can affect metabolism, cognitive function, and cardiovascular health.
